The diagnostic sequence determines everything in Pinole. EZ Open performs the manual release test first on every won't-open call in Pinole, CA. The emergency release cord is pulled to disconnect the door from the opener trolley in Pinole. The door is manually lifted in Pinole, CA. If the door lifts easily and holds its position, the opener is the source of the problem in Pinole. If the door is very heavy or won't hold a raised position, the spring has failed and the opener symptom is a consequence of the spring failure in Pinole, CA. If the door won't move at all manually, the door is physically stuck from a cable failure, track obstruction, or off-track condition in Pinole. Three completely different repair paths determined by a thirty-second test in Pinole, CA. This test is why EZ Open doesn't replace the opener when the spring is the problem in Pinole.

Every Cause of a Garage Door That Won't Open in Pinole, CA

Broken Spring — Door Too Heavy for the Opener in Pinole

A broken torsion spring removes the counterbalancing force that makes the door movable by the opener in Pinole, CA. The opener provides 10 to 20 pounds of net lifting force against a counterbalanced door in Pinole. Without spring counterbalancing, the opener is trying to lift 150 to 400 pounds with 10 to 20 pounds of force in Pinole, CA. The manual release test reveals a heavy door that won't hold its position in Pinole. A visible gap in the torsion spring coil confirms the break in Pinole, CA.

Broken or Disconnected Cable — Door Jammed in Track in Pinole, CA

A broken cable allows one side of the door to drop, tilting the door in the track in Pinole. The tilted door is physically jammed against the track walls and can't travel in either direction in Pinole, CA. The manual release test reveals a door that won't move at all in Pinole. Inspection finds a loose cable at the bottom corner of the lower side in Pinole, CA. Cable replacement and spring assessment are required in Pinole.

Opener Component Failure — Motor, Logic Board, or Drive in Pinole, CA

A failed opener component prevents the opener from producing the force needed to move the door in Pinole. The manual release test reveals a door that lifts easily and holds its position in Pinole, CA. The door hardware is functioning correctly in Pinole. The opener is the source of the symptom in Pinole, CA. Component assessment identifies the specific failed component in Pinole.

Disconnected Trolley Carriage — The Most Overlooked Cause in Pinole, CA

The emergency release cord disconnects the trolley carriage from the trolley in Pinole. If the carriage was disconnected and not reconnected, the opener runs the trolley along the rail while the carriage and door sit stationary in Pinole, CA. The door appears completely unopened and unresponsive in Pinole. The manual release test reveals a door that lifts easily because the carriage is already disconnected in Pinole, CA. Reconnecting the carriage to the trolley resolves the symptom immediately in Pinole. No component is damaged or failed in Pinole, CA.

Door Off Track — Physical Blockage in Travel Path in Pinole

A door that has come off its track has a roller outside the track channel creating a physical blockage in Pinole, CA. The door can't travel in either direction through the blockage in Pinole. The manual release test reveals a door that won't move at all in Pinole, CA. Visual inspection finds the roller or rollers outside the track channel in Pinole. Off-track repair with cause identification is required before the door can open correctly in Pinole, CA.

Dead Remote Battery — Check This First in Pinole

A dead remote battery produces a door that doesn't respond to the remote in Pinole, CA. The wall button will operate the door normally in Pinole. If the door opens with the wall button but not the remote, replace the remote battery before calling for service in Pinole, CA. A new battery resolves this in approximately two minutes in Pinole. If the door doesn't respond to either the remote or the wall button, the problem is in the opener or door hardware and a service call is warranted in Pinole, CA.

Frozen Floor Seal — Cold Weather Specific in Pinole, CA

In cold climates, water from condensation or melting snow freezes at the contact point between the door's bottom seal and the garage floor overnight in Pinole. The frozen bond holds the door to the floor despite the opener providing its normal lifting force in Pinole, CA. The manual release test typically reveals a door that's very difficult to lift manually as the ice bond resists upward force in Pinole. Gentle heat application at the floor seal breaks the ice bond in most cases in Pinole, CA. Do not run the opener repeatedly against a frozen door in Pinole.

Track Obstruction or Damage — Blocking Roller Travel in Pinole, CA

An object in the track, debris accumulation at a specific point, or a bent track section narrows the channel below the roller diameter in Pinole. The door opens to the obstruction point and stops in Pinole, CA. The manual release test may show the door lifting partially and then stopping at the obstruction in Pinole. Track clearing or track repair is required to restore full travel in Pinole, CA.

What to Do Before EZ Open Arrives in Pinole, CA

Try the Wall Button and Check the Remote Battery in Pinole

Before any other action, try the wall button inside the garage in Pinole, CA. If the wall button opens the door, the problem is with the remote rather than the door or opener in Pinole. Replace the remote battery first in Pinole, CA. If the wall button also produces no response, the problem is in the opener or door hardware and EZ Open's service is needed in Pinole.

Check Whether the Emergency Release Was Left Disconnected in Pinole, CA

Look at the opener trolley and the carriage bracket that connects to the door in Pinole. If the carriage hook is hanging freely rather than engaged in the trolley, the emergency release was pulled and not reconnected in Pinole, CA. Pull the red emergency release cord toward the door to re-engage the carriage in Pinole. If the door then opens with the opener, no repair was needed in Pinole, CA.

Look at the Spring Above the Door for a Visible Gap in Pinole

Look at the torsion spring on the shaft above the door opening in Pinole, CA. A broken spring has a visible gap in the otherwise continuous coil where the wire separated in Pinole. If a gap is visible, do not attempt to open the door in Pinole, CA. Call EZ Open for same-day broken spring repair in Pinole.

Do Not Force the Door in Pinole, CA

Running the opener repeatedly against a door that won't open risks stripping the drive gear in Pinole. Manually pulling a door that's jammed from a cable failure or off-track condition can damage the panel at the force application point in Pinole, CA. Forcing a door with a broken cable can release the door suddenly in Pinole. The cost of the forced damage adds to whatever the original repair cost would have been in Pinole, CA.

How to Access the Garage Safely if You Absolutely Must in Pinole

If you must access the garage before EZ Open arrives in Pinole, CA, use the external keyed emergency release if your door has one in Pinole. If not, use the manual release cord carefully with at least one other person present in Pinole, CA. With a broken spring, the door is very heavy and will not hold a raised position in Pinole. Lift only the minimum amount required and do not stand under the door in Pinole, CA.

A clicking sound without any door or motor movement often points to the opener's relay engaging without the motor actually starting in Pinole. This can indicate a failed motor capacitor that prevents the motor from starting despite the control circuit functioning correctly in Pinole, CA. It can also indicate the logic board attempting to start the cycle and immediately detecting a fault condition in Pinole. EZ Open isolates whether the issue is in the motor circuit or the control circuit through systematic testing in Pinole, CA.
Two common causes are specific to cold weather in Pinole. A frozen bottom seal that's bonded to the garage floor overnight can hold the door down despite normal opener force in Pinole, CA. And cold temperatures can affect the consistency of grease and lubricant in the opener's drive mechanism, increasing resistance enough to trigger the force limit in Pinole. EZ Open distinguishes between these two causes based on whether the door is difficult to lift manually or whether the opener stops and reverses early in the cycle in Pinole, CA.
Not directly, since the garage door opener runs on household electrical power rather than the vehicle's battery in Pinole. However, if you're using a vehicle-mounted remote or a smartphone app that relies on the vehicle's electronics to relay the signal, a dead car battery could prevent that specific control method from working in Pinole, CA. The wall button and a standard handheld remote would be unaffected in Pinole.
A sudden change from working to not working overnight points to a few likely causes in Pinole. A spring that finally failed after gradually weakening, since the failure point is often abrupt even though the wear was gradual in Pinole, CA. A power outage or surge that affected the opener's logic board in Pinole. Or a remote that lost its programming sync, especially if it was activated accidentally and repeatedly while not near the opener in Pinole, CA. EZ Open's diagnostic sequence quickly narrows down which of these applies in Pinole.
Yes, every residential garage door opener includes a manual emergency release in Pinole. Pull the cord with the red handle hanging from the trolley to disconnect the door from the opener in Pinole, CA. Once disconnected, the door can be lifted by hand if the spring system is functioning correctly in Pinole. If the door feels very heavy when lifted manually, do not continue, this indicates a spring problem rather than an opener problem in Pinole, CA.
This typically indicates the opener's force limit is being triggered almost immediately in Pinole. The most common cause is a spring that's lost significant tension, making the door effectively much heavier right from the start of the lift in Pinole, CA. A track obstruction at the very bottom of the door's travel path or a force limit setting that's too sensitive for the current door weight are other possibilities in Pinole. EZ Open checks spring balance first since it's the most common cause of this specific symptom in Pinole, CA.
Yes in Pinole. A power surge from a lightning strike or grid fluctuation can damage the opener's logic board, sometimes immediately and sometimes with a delayed failure that appears days later in Pinole, CA. Storm-related power outages can also occasionally cause an opener's settings to reset, which sometimes resolves on its own and sometimes requires reprogramming in Pinole. EZ Open checks the logic board and the opener's settings when a storm or outage timing lines up with the failure in Pinole, CA.
This usually indicates the opener isn't correctly detecting that the door has reached its travel limit in Pinole. The travel limit sensor or switch may have failed, or the limit settings may have been knocked out of calibration in Pinole, CA. This is different from a force limit issue, which causes the opener to stop short, this is a failure to recognize the door has finished its travel in Pinole. EZ Open recalibrates or repairs the limit detection system to resolve this in Pinole, CA.
If the opener is making unusual sounds, smells like it's overheating, or you've been repeatedly trying to operate it against resistance, unplugging it is a reasonable precaution in Pinole. Otherwise, there's no need to unplug it before EZ Open's visit, since our technician will need to test it as part of the diagnosis in Pinole, CA. Just avoid continuing to operate it repeatedly while waiting in Pinole.
It's uncommon but possible in Pinole. A new remote that wasn't correctly programmed to the opener's rolling code system, has a defective battery installed at the factory, or has a manufacturing defect can fail immediately in Pinole, CA. Before assuming a defect, confirm the remote is correctly programmed by following the manufacturer's pairing sequence, since this is the more common cause of a new remote not working in Pinole.
